A Cleveland staple of kielbasa, French fries, barbecue sauce, and slaw stuffed in a bun. It reflects the city's Eastern European and blue-collar food traditions.
Hearty Slovak-style stuffed cabbage rolls baked in tomato sauce. They are traditional in many Cleveland immigrant families and church festival menus.
Crisp potato pancakes often served with applesauce or sour cream. They are closely tied to Cleveland's strong Central and Eastern European heritage.
Beloved deli famous for towering corned beef sandwiches. Casual, no-frills, and widely considered a Cleveland institution.
